Knowing the right people in professional contexts and being able to influence them is crucial to the transition from student to career professional.

‘Mind the Gap: Networking for success’ is a 3-hour workshop designed to help graduate students develop interpersonal skills and practise networking skills to use with professionals. Learn how to build successful relationships in the work of work.
You will participate in exercises that will help you to communicate with confidence, build your professional network and enhance your professional profile. This is workshop is useful for students at any stage of their degree.
